COME DINE WITH NE1 The latest NE1’s Newcastle Restaurant Week, which took place August 4-10, was the biggest yet and a huge commercial success as a staggering 20,000-plus people enjoyed special offers at restaurants across the city centre. The event added hundreds of thousands of pounds to the city’s economy, with more than 20,000 vouchers redeemed at restaurants during the week. Want to help break the record again? The ninth NE1’s Newcastle Restaurant Week takes place in January 2015. www.getintonewcastle.co.uk
